Queen of Pentacles – Golden Dawn

Golden Dawn title

Queen of the Thrones of Earth

Divinatory meanings

She is impetuous, kind, timid, rather charming, greathearted, intelligent, melancholy, truthful, yet of many moods.

Ill-dignified

She is undecided, capricious, foolish, changeable.

MacGregor Mathers

A dark Woman, generous, Liberality, Greatness of Soul, Generosity.

Reversed

Certain Evil, a suspicious Woman, justly regarded with Suspicion, Doubt, Mistrust.

Attributions

Symbols

  • Desert
  • Goat
  • Sceptre
  • Cube
  • Orb

Elemental

Water of Earth

Zodiacal

20° Sagittarius to 20° Capricorn
